title: NoSQL数据库之HBase date: 2020-05-26 15:19:46 categories:
定义
HBase是一种分布式、可扩展、支持海量数据存储的NoSQL数据库。
数据量大的时候适合此选型,能做到几十亿条数据秒级查询。反之优势不是很明显,比较耗资源。
数据模型
逻辑上,HBase的数据模型同关系型数据库很类似,数据存储在一张表中,有行有列。
但从 HBase的底层物理存储结构(K-V)来看,HBase更像是一个multi-dimensional map。
逻辑结构